According to current reports, its likely that credit card companies will be spending less on television spots in 4Q. The service which tracks advertising spends by industry, Nielsen Monitor-Plus, forecasts that ad spending for credit card services could continue to fall 20% from just a year ago.
In September, the ad volume for companies that promote a Mastercard, Visa or other brand was down 24% versus September of 2007. Advertising volume had been higher during mid-summer, but the recent financial meltdown has caused a shift in increased cost control.
Not surprisingly, marketers of mortgage services dropped by 50% in September, which was consistent with mid-summer declines for the segment.
